Before Storm connections and Sparking! meteor combos became standard, anime arena fighters were simpler—but not necessarily worse. , released exclusively for the PlayStation 2 in 2006 (Japan only), is a prime example. Developed by Racjin and published by Sony Computer Entertainment , this 3D arena brawler delivered fast-paced, four-player chaotic action based on the Soul Society arc.
